Butcher Boots — Footwear for Earning Through Harvesting

The “Butcher Boots” are a foot-slot armor piece themed, as the name suggests, around harvesting and butchering. On their own they function as ordinary boots that protect your feet, but they truly shine when you equip the matching Butcher gear pieces together.

Intended Direction

Armor in 7 Days to Die is designed so that assembling a full matching series grants a set bonus. The Butcher line can be thought of as a series geared toward hunting and butchering efficiency—such as an increased yield of meat, fat, and materials from animals and enemies. It’s a great fit for securing food in the early to mid game, or when you want a steady supply of crafting materials like fat and bone.

When to Use It

  • Wearing it during base work that revolves around hunting and animal husbandry lets the materials you gain from each butchering job pile up.
  • Since it isn’t combat-focused, it’s best to switch to a more defensively capable set when heading into dangerous areas.
  • Even just the foot slot on its own makes a solid starting point for assembling the Butcher line one piece at a time.

It’s a dependable support-type piece of gear that comes into its own whenever you want to “bring back even a little more” meat and materials.
